The fseek() function seeks in an open file. It returns 0 on success, else returns -1 on failure.
Syntax
fseek(file_pointer, offset, whence)
Parameters
file_pointer − A file pointer created using fopen(). Required.
offset − Specify the new position. Required.
whence − The following are the values:
- SEEK_SET - Set position equal to offset bytes. Default.
- SEEK_CUR - Set position to current location plus offset.
- SEEK_END - Set position to end-of-file plus offset.
Return
The fseek() function returns 0 on success, else returns -1 on failure.
